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Bell Hill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Bell Hill?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Bell Hill is at Colton Apartments listed at $1,200.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Bell Hill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Bell Hill is $2,260.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Bell Hill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Bell Hill is a 3,419 square feet unit starting from $2,379 at Courthouse Lofts.

What is the average size for Bell Hill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Bell Hill is currently at 910 sq ft.
